Many individuals find immediate relief by adding a few drops to a bowl of hot water for steam inhalation or using it in a diffuser during illness. This volatile oil is primarily composed of eucalyptol, also known as 1,8-cineole, a compound responsible for many of its characteristic benefits, including its potent ant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ory effects.

Eucalyptus essential oil, distilled from the leaves of the eucalyptus tree native to Australia, has secured its place as a cornerstone in modern aromatherapy and natural wellness. Its cooling effect on the skin distracts from deeper pain signals, offering a natural method for temporary relief.

Use in a diffuser to purify the air and ease breathing. When dealing with congestion, colds, or sinus pressure, the oil acts as a powerful expectorant, helping to loosen and expel mucus from the respiratory tract.
